What is a fall detector pendant alarm?

A fall detector pendant alarm is a compact, lightweight device that automatically senses when the wearer slips or falls over. Once the device detects a fall, it’ll raise an alarm, automatically contacting a 24/7 Customer Care team to assist you. In addition to the automatic trigger, many pendant alarms also have a call button you can press any time you need help.

How does a fall detector pendant alarm work?

Most fall detector pendant alarms work the same way. They can be worn around your neck (like a lanyard) or wrist (as a bracelet). Some can even be hooked on your belt or pinned on your shirt (like a brooch!).

These devices are equipped with sensors that can detect quick and sudden changes in your position, usually indicating a slip or fall. Some even have sensors that can gauge how severe your fall is!

Once the pendant alarm detects a fall, it will alert a partner customer care team that will assess your situation and send the necessary help your way. Many of today’s fall detectors also have GPS that helps emergency units pinpoint your exact location.

Pendant alarms are also useful even when you don’t encounter a fall. Many of today’s devices have a call button you can use to manually send an alert to the same 24/7 Customer Care team anytime you need help, have an accident, or feel unsafe.

What happens in the case of a false alarm? Different pendant alarms have their own ways of cancelling false alerts. Some may require you to double press the call button or cover a sensor to stop the alarm from connecting to customer care. Make sure to read the pendant’s user guide to know exactly how this is done for your particular device.

When should I be wearing a fall detector pendant alarm?

Ideally, fall detector pendants should be worn at all times.

This is because accidents like falls and slips can happen at any time and anywhere. In fact, the Australian Institute of Health and Welfare 2019 Falls Report noted that 100,000 people aged 65 and over were hospitalised due to a fall from 2016 to 2017 alone!

While accidents can’t be 100% avoided, a fall detector pendant alarm can get you the help you need that much faster. The sooner you call for help, the higher your chances of making a full recovery.

What is Connected Care?

Tunstall Healthcare’s concept of Connected Care uses devices or solutions that link people with their healthcare providers. Examples of these solutions include remote monitoring devices and round-the-clock support services.

Through Connected Care, doctors and health care providers remotely access their patients’ records and check-up on them via smart devices and monitoring solutions. This is especially useful for patients who have limited access to healthcare, or aren’t able to be seen on a regular basis due to distance, condition, or other circumstances. Connected Care makes accessing healthcare that much easier because of devices and solutions that facilitate remote care.

Tunstall’s Connected Care and Connected Health services also transmit data to Tunstall’s ICP myMobile application. Key insights regarding a person’s health can be analysed here, either by the person’s carer or by the person themselves. This allows people to stay on top of their condition, empowering them to control their own care.

The accuracy and timeliness of this data allows health care providers to diagnose patients more efficiently and create treatment plans tailored to a person’s specific symptoms. Early diagnosis also keeps a patient’s condition from worsening. In the long run, this can save patients from making multiple trips to the doctor, and improve the overall quality of their care.

How does Connected Care work?

Connected Care is a system that connects patients and carers through modern healthcare solutions. These solutions include individual devices and sensors patients like you can carry around wherever you go or installed right in your home.

These devices are often equipped with sensors to detect when you fall, slip, or have a seizure. Once they detect this, the device triggers an alarm that alerts Tunstall’s 24/7 Customer Care team. One of our representatives will contact you, assess your situation, and send the necessary emergency units your way. Some devices also allow you to manually call for help, giving you the chance to live independently yet securely as possible.
